Description

Late 19th century. Arts and crafts 2-storey asymmetrical

cottage built as servants lodging to Milton Park. Roughcast

with polished sandstone margins, tiled roof.

Irregular main elevation with recessed door to extreme left.

Advanced gabled bay with tripartite windows, to right deeply

projecting bowed bay with 5-light windows. Each group of

lights set in panel of sandstone masonry with common

hoodmould. To right square headed pend to rear court with

lattice-wall to eaves screening linking passage. Steeply

pitched tile roof with ceramic finials to gables, axial

stacks wit octagonal cans.
